Comparing Honda and Maruti Diesel Engines: Reliability, Cost-Effectiveness and Maintenance
When choosing between Honda and Maruti diesel engines, several factors need to be taken into account. This article will delve into the key points of reliability, cost-effectiveness, and maintenance to help you make an informed decision.
Reliability
Honda Diesel Engines: Known for their engineering quality and reliability, Honda diesel engines are designed to last. Models like the Honda City are celebrated for their robustness and longevity, making them a top choice for those prioritizing reliability.
Maruti Diesel Engines: Maruti has also earned a reputation for reliability, with popular models like the Swift and Dzire leading the way. Maruti engines are praised for their efficiency and durability, often noted for their simplicity and longevity.
Cost-Effectiveness
Honda Diesel Engines: Honda vehicles typically have a higher initial purchase price compared to Maruti. Despite this higher initial cost, Honda vehicles often enjoy better resale value over time due to the brand's reputation for quality and reliability.
Maruti Diesel Engines: Maruti vehicles are generally more affordable at the point of purchase and cater to a wide range of budget segments. They often come with lower insurance costs and an extensive service network, which can significantly reduce overall ownership costs over time.
Maintenance
Honda Diesel Engines: While Honda is highly reliable, its maintenance costs can be slightly higher due to its premium positioning. However, Honda vehicles often require less frequent repairs due to their superior build quality.
Maruti Diesel Engines: Maruti vehicles are known for their lower maintenance costs. Their vast service network across India makes it easier and often cheaper to find parts and service, which is a significant advantage for long-term ownership.
Conclusion
If you prioritize long-term reliability and resale value, Honda may be the better choice, albeit at a higher initial cost. For those looking for a more budget-friendly option with lower maintenance costs, Maruti is likely the better choice.
